Moroccan forward Hamza Igamane scores sensational hat-trick for Rangers in thriller against Hibernian

Moroccan forward Hamza Igamane stole the show on Sunday, scoring a stunning hat-trick for Rangers in a dramatic 3-3 draw against Hibernian in the Scottish Premiership.

The 22-year-old, who joined Rangers from AS FAR Rabat last summer, delivered a dazzling display of skill and composure.

Igamane opened the scoring in the 4th minute with a precise left-footed strike, followed it up with a towering header in the 19th minute, and completed his hat-trick with a powerful right-footed finish in the 73rd minute.

Despite his heroics, Rangers were unable to secure the win, as Hibernian fought back each time to level the match. The result keeps Rangers in second place on the table, trailing rivals Celtic by nine points.

Igamane’s performance underscores his meteoric rise and consistency since joining the Scottish giants. With nine goals in his last 11 appearances across all competitions, the Temara-born striker is quickly becoming one of the league’s standout players.

Rangers fans will be hoping Igamane’s form continues as the season progresses, with his blend of technical ability and clinical finishing providing a crucial edge to their attacking lineup.
